Lovina Graves was born in 1805 in Vermont, United States of America, the child of Horace Graves And Lucretia Reynolds. Lovina Graves had children including Elizabeth. Lovina Graves passed away in 1878 in Byron, Fond du Lac County, Wisconsin, United States of America.
